Description

5-Methyl-2-(Trifluoromethylthio)Aniline is a specialized aromatic amine derivative featuring a trifluoromethylthio substituent, which imparts unique electronic and steric properties. This compound serves as a critical high-value building block in advanced organic synthesis, particularly for the development of novel active ingredients. It is primarily required by pharmaceutical and agrochemical R&D teams for creating new molecules with enhanced biological activity and metabolic stability.

Basic Information

Product Name 5-Methyl-2-(Trifluoromethylthio)Aniline
CAS No. 1154963-60-6
Molecular Formula C8H8F3NS
Molecular Weight 207.22 g/mol
Synonyms 2-Amino-4-methylphenyl trifluoromethyl sulfide; 2-(Trifluoromethylthio)-5-methylaniline; 5-Methyl-2-((trifluoromethyl)thio)benzenamine; 2-(Trifluoromethylsulfanyl)-5-methylaniline; 4-Methyl-2-aminophenyl trifluoromethyl thioether; Benzenamine, 5-methyl-2-[(trifluoromethyl)thio]-; 5-Methyl-α,α,α-trifluoro-o-aminothioanisole

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its amine functionality and light-sensitive nature, prolonged exposure to air and light should be avoided.
